Best beaches in Malta

Here is a list of a few best beaches that you must visit in Malta during your trip. Let us know about them in detail:

Riviera Beach

It is a well-known beach in Malta that has blue water, soft sand, and incredible seaside views. This beach is less crowded compared to others. You can go to this beach by climbing 100 steps and enjoy the manmade amenities and natural sights.

GoldenBay Beach

It’s a family-friendly picturesque beach that has a well-managed environment. It is pretty expansive and has various rooms, hillsides, and shrub-covered cliffs. Plus, it has a range of amenities like changing rooms, beach umbrellas, lounge chairs, spa, resorts, and more to relax with your family. This beach has crystal-clear water, which is ideal to swim and snorkel. It will have blur flags that indicate security warnings.

RamlaBay Beach

It is the prettiest beach in Malta as it has reddish soft sand. The blue water makes it perfect to swim, particularly with children. In addition to this, you can also visit the historical site - ancient Roman buildings and view the Cave of Calypso - a nymph who is beloved by the sun, Apollo (Greek God).

Blue Lagoon

Blue Lagoon is just like paradise, so it is attracted by a wide range of visitors. In the summer season, you have to brace yourself from the crowds. It looks like a recreational center with children swimming and visitors stretching out in the rocky hillside.

Fomm ir-Rih

It is the most isolated and wildest beach in Malta that has access through a perpendicular climb. The efforts are worthy as the beach has a beautiful view of the Mediterranean Sea, valleys, underwater views, and cliffs. When the wind blows from the northwest or north, then the weaves are quite forceful.

Armier Bay

This beach is the best alternative to others like Mellieha Bay as it has a serene ambiance. It is crystal clear and clean with tender waves. You will find beach umbrellas, lounge chairs, and equipment for water sports on rent. It is exposed to open sea (dangerous undercurrents), so ask the locals regarding the safety before you get into the water.

In addition to this, there are other popular beaches, such as Mellieha Bay, Hondoq Ir-Rummien Beach, St. George’s Beach, St. Peter's Pool, and Mgarr ix-Xini Bay.
